What To Be Fair keeps, and where.

This is a public statement, so it says the less comfortable half at the same weight as the other.

Your statements

Your statements, your photographs and your pause plan are kept by us, on Amazon Web Services in London, so that a new phone gets them back by signing in and so that your partner's phone can receive what you wrote. They are encrypted on the way to us and while they are stored, and a copy sits on each of your two phones so the app works with no signal.

We can read them. That is the plain truth of keeping something on a server, and we would rather say it than imply otherwise. Nobody at To Be Fair reads a statement except at the written request of the person who wrote it, and there is no screen, tool or report inside the company that lists them. A court order could compel us to produce them; we would tell you if the law allowed it.

What we hold about you

Your Sign in with Apple identifier, and the name and email address Apple gave us when you first signed in, including a private relay address if you chose to hide your email. Your account holds no statements itself: it is what lets a new phone find your partner and your statements again.

Each phone has an identifier and a notification token so we can send it a silent update or the one pause line you agreed with your partner in advance. We never send your partner anything you did not agree to.

What we count

Seven kinds of event, under a random identifier that is not your account and cannot be joined to it: a hearing opened, a card viewed, what you chose after, a pause line sent, a write-it-out finished, a statement deposited, and the widget shown. No text, no names, no length of anything you wrote. Crash reports carry a separate random identifier, shown to you in Settings as your Diagnostic ID, and are scrubbed of content before they leave the phone.

This website sets no cookies and runs no script. Nothing here watches you.

What stays on your phone only

What you write on the Write it out page. It is never sent anywhere, not even to your own second phone, and it is included in your PDF export because it is yours.

Deleting

Delete everything, on the Settings screen, deletes your account, every statement and photograph of yours on our servers, and everything in the app on your phone, immediately, and shows you a receipt listing each store that was cleared. Your partner keeps what is on their phone. We ask Apple to revoke your Sign in with Apple authorisation at the same time. Sign out deletes nothing.
